Propaganda grew up in a working class black family and lived in a predominant Latino neighborhood of LAThere was a sense of multiculturalism from the very beginning and Prop saw how one personʼs problem could very similar to that of another person. For Prop, music is way to create conversations about substantial entities that impact us on a daily basis and to see how faith can help guide us along the way. After he graduated college with degrees in illustration and intercultural studies, he taught high school for six years and had a hand in founding two charter schools in LA, one of which had a focus on the arts. 2007 he resigned from teaching to pursue music full-time and began touring as a solo artist. He joined the Humble Beast family and unveiled a series of four albums that put his music on the map. THOMAS J. TERRY serves as the Lead Pastor of The Trinity Church in Portland Oregon. He is also the founder and executive director of Humble Beast, a record label and ministry in Portland, Oregon. As a spoken word artist and a member of Beautiful Eulogy, he seeks to bring creativity and theology together to glorify the Lord who created them both. In this episode of the 5 Leadership Questions Podcast Todd Adkins and Barnabas Piper talk with Thomas Terry, hip hop artist as well as co-founder and current owner of Humble Beast. Humble Beast is a record label and a community of creative people seeking to show Jesus to the world and express truth with creativity and excellence. They do this through music, apparel, conferences and events, and even coffee in the past. The conversation is wide ranging and has a unique flavor because of Thomas's and Humble Beast's emphasis on creativity and artistry. This week I had the pleasure of interviewing Thomas Terry aka Odd Thomas, founder of Humble Beast, in regards to starting and running the record label. Humble Beast Records is unique in that they give all of their albums away free on their website. Thomas discusses what they label does to financially support the label and how they have been able to flourish in the market.
